Arctic Tern (Sterna paradisaea) ARTE

I have not photographed birds much in the UK, primarily because of lack of time. When I have searched for birds though, I found it quite difficult as the birds have proved to be extremely skittish, perhaps because of fairly regular hunting guns and the lack of woods. However, I visited the small northern Scottish town of Brora in July 2010, and found a colony of breeding Arctic Terns by the famous golf links. This spot is an established nesting ground for them. They are the longest migratory bird in the world, and at the end of the breeding season they will fly to the Antarctic to spend the northern hemisphere winters.
